About the Role

A Group of Companies is looking for a CMA, ACCA, MCOM or CA Inter qualified accountant with a minimum of 3 years experience to join our dynamic team in Dubai.

Responsibilities
  • Maintain monthly operating budget cash flow forecasts and process expenses, accounts and payments.
  • Prepare and review management accounts and performance reports for the company and its entities.
  • Maintain operating budget and expenses tracking.
  • Cash flow forecasting.
  • Ensure that all transactions are well documented.
  • Prepare asset, liability and capital accounts.
  • Keep and maintain all the books in perfect order.
  • Summarise current financial situation by analysing current liabilities, preparing a profit and loss statement and indicating corrective actions.
  • Audit key documents and verify each transaction.
  • Ensure the accuracy of financial documents and their compliance with relevant laws and regulations.
  • Prepare and maintain important financial reports.
  • Prepare tax returns and ensure that taxes are paid properly and on time.
  • Evaluate financial operations to recommend best practices, identify issues, strategise solutions and help organisations run efficiently.
  • Offer guidance on cost reduction, revenue enhancement and profit maximisation.
  • Conduct forecasting and risk analysis assessments.
  • Able to do payroll as well.
  • Experience in Tally ERP and salary processing.
